Off the Rails: M.F.A. Thesis II
Friday, April 6–Sunday, April 15
Reception: Friday, April 13, 5–7 p.m.
Gallery Talk: Tuesday, April 10, 2:45–5 p.m., beginning at Cohen Plaza; Wednesday, April 11, 1–3:30 p.m., beginning in Meyerhoff Gallery; Friday, April 13, 10-10:30 a.m., at North Avenue Market
Featuring: Misha Capecchi (Mount Royal), Micheal Cor (Hoffberger), Noel Cunningham (Graphic Design), Zoe Friedman (Mount Royal), Jessica Gibson (Photographic & Electronic Media), Timothy Hoover (Graphic Design), Julie Horton (Hoffberger), So Hyun An (Photographic & Electronic Media), Abdulmari Imao (Rinehart), Jessica Karle (Graphic Design), Jonathan Latiano (Mount Royal), Aviv Lichter (Graphic Design), Lloyd Lowe (Photographic & Electronic Media), Travis Masingale (Photographic & Electronic Media), Skye McNeill (Graphic Design), Laini Nemett (Hoffberger), Margaret Rogers (Mount Royal), Michal Rotberg (Graphic Design) and Jen Smith (Photographic & Electronic Media)
